Bumps json from 0.11.15 to 0.12.4.

Release notes

Sourced from json's releases.

0.12.4

  • Fixes an issue with new macros requiring types to be copy.

0.12.3

  • Improved macro syntax:
    • Object "key" => value pair can be now written as either "key": value or key: value without quotes, as long as key is an identifier.
    • If you want to use the value of the a variable as a key in the new notation, use [foo]: value.
    • When nesting objects or arrays, it's no longer necessary to use invoke array! or object! from within another macro.
    • null is a keyword inside of either macro.
    • This is a backwards compatible change, although mixing notations within a single macro invocation is not permitted.

Example

Instead of:

let obj = object! {
    "foo" => array![1, 2, json::Null],
    "bar" => 42
};

You can now write:

let obj = object! {
    foo: [1, 2, null],
    bar: 42
};

0.12.2

  • Fixes #152 & #153.
  • Fixed a whole bunch of warnings and some formatting.

0.12.1

  • Fixes panics in string generation (#168).
  • Fixes an old link to documentation in doc comments (#170).

0.12.0

  • Updated to edition 2018.
  • Simplified reading escaped unicode in strings a bit.
  • Provided From<&[T]> implementation for JsonValue where T: Into<JsonValue> (closes #160).
  • object! and array! macros will no longer re-allocate (closes #159).
  • object! and array! macros can be now used without being imported into local scope (by using json::object! or json::array!, thanks @matthias-t).
  • BREAKING HashMap and BTreeMap conversions are now more generic, working for any pair of K key and V value where K: AsRef<str> and V: Into<JsonValue>. This means that type inference won't always work in your favor, but should be much more flexible.
  • You can now .collect() an interator of (K, V) (with bounds same as point above) into an Object.
